Output 889455d853f8694a21c5e8924d24ab6c491bf337795294ba05860bd2cb424792: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373a6e5fbc84f1a386aeff5ea734b9999dcb0 OP_EQUAL
address
3BMEX1bn4JrgN4x5g5AL9mHsMEekuWhHqA
transaction
889455d853f8694a21c5e8924d24ab6c491bf337795294ba05860bd2cb424792
spent
true